My poor old Mama Dog is ready to have pups any time. This will be her second litter, but her first during the heat. The Summer weather bothers Great Pyrenees anyway, but it really bothers a pregnant one. I'm kinda glad that my husband is on the night shift and sleeps through the heat of the day. He doesn't see those two big dogs take a swim in his Koi Ponds. to funny

These dogs are so neat. The spots will fade into their undercoats and they will all be white. The pup Mandy has had a totally brown colored head. Now you just see a hint of color under and amongst the white. I keep asking myself why I waited 45 yrs to ever get a Great Pyrenese. They are a super good dog all the way round. Smile
